IOS Developer Salary In Egypt: A Comprehensive Guide
Hey guys! Ever wondered about the iOS developer salary in Egypt? Well, you're in the right place! This article is your ultimate guide, breaking down everything you need to know about the average iOS developer salary in Egypt, the factors influencing it, and some tips to boost your earning potential. Whether you're a seasoned pro or just starting your coding journey, this is your one-stop resource. We'll delve into the nitty-gritty of salaries, the job market, and what it takes to succeed in the Egyptian iOS development scene. So, buckle up, and let's get started!
Decoding the iOS Developer Salary Landscape in Egypt
Alright, let's get down to brass tacks: what kind of money can you expect to make as an iOS developer in Egypt? The iOS developer salary in Egypt can vary quite a bit, depending on a bunch of different factors, which we will explore. But to give you a general idea, let’s look at the average. Keep in mind that these are just averages, and your actual salary will depend on your experience, skills, and the specific company you work for. The job market is constantly evolving, so these numbers can shift, but they give a good starting point for your research. The salary usually varies based on your experience level: entry-level developers might start with a lower salary, while experienced developers can command significantly higher pay. Your location within Egypt also matters. For instance, Cairo and Alexandria, being major tech hubs, may offer higher salaries than other regions due to a greater demand and higher cost of living. Keep in mind that the current economic climate in Egypt and the global tech market can impact salaries. Economic fluctuations, inflation rates, and the overall health of the tech industry can all play a role in how much companies are willing to pay. Therefore, it's super important to stay updated on the latest trends and reports about the job market. This also means your hard skills are essential. Proficiency in Swift and Objective-C is a must, but other skills can set you apart. Do you know about design patterns, networking, and data storage? Those skills can significantly increase your market value. We will look at some of those crucial skills later in the article. So, stick around!
Factors Influencing iOS Developer Salaries
Okay, guys, let's explore the key factors that significantly affect the iOS developer salary you can expect in Egypt. We already talked about some of them, but let’s dive deeper, shall we? First up, experience matters a lot. If you're fresh out of school or just starting, you'll likely begin with an entry-level salary. But as you gain more experience, your salary will naturally increase. With each year of experience, you'll become more skilled, and your ability to tackle complex projects will grow, making you a more valuable asset to companies. Secondly, let's consider the skills. Solid proficiency in Swift and Objective-C are essential, but the more you know, the better. Knowledge of frameworks like UIKit, Core Data, and Core Animation is super important. Experience with testing frameworks, version control systems (like Git), and understanding of software design principles also boost your value. Also, certifications. Any certifications related to iOS development, like those from Apple, can significantly boost your credibility and potentially increase your salary. They demonstrate a commitment to continuous learning and can showcase your expertise to potential employers. Another factor to consider is the size and type of the company. Larger multinational corporations or well-established tech companies often have bigger budgets and can offer higher salaries than smaller startups. Then comes the location, as we mentioned before. Major cities like Cairo and Alexandria tend to have a higher demand for iOS developers and, therefore, offer more competitive salaries. This is influenced by the cost of living and the concentration of tech companies in these areas. Don’t forget about the industry you work in. Some industries, like fintech or e-commerce, might pay more due to the higher demand for iOS developers in those sectors. Finally, your negotiation skills are key. Knowing your worth and being able to effectively negotiate your salary can significantly impact your take-home pay. Researching industry standards and being prepared to discuss your skills and experience can go a long way.
Average Salary Ranges: Entry-Level, Mid-Level, and Senior iOS Developers
Now, let's break down the average salary ranges for iOS developers in Egypt based on their experience levels. This should give you a clearer picture of what to expect at different stages of your career. Keep in mind, again, that these are estimates, and your actual salary may vary. Let's start with entry-level iOS developers. These are developers with little to no experience, often fresh graduates or those with a few months of experience. The entry-level iOS developer salary in Egypt typically ranges from EGP 8,000 to EGP 15,000 per month. This range can depend on their education, the specific skills they possess, and the location of the job. Next up are mid-level iOS developers. With a few years of experience under their belts, they've gained a solid understanding of iOS development and can handle more complex projects. The mid-level iOS developer salary in Egypt usually falls between EGP 15,000 to EGP 30,000 per month. Developers at this level are expected to have strong skills, be able to work independently, and contribute to team projects effectively. Last, but not least, we have senior iOS developers. These are the veterans of the iOS development world, with extensive experience and expertise. They're often team leads or have specialized knowledge. The senior iOS developer salary in Egypt can range from EGP 30,000 to EGP 60,000 or even higher per month, depending on their skills, experience, and the company they work for. They typically have a deep understanding of iOS development best practices, are capable of leading projects, and often mentor junior developers. Remember that these ranges are general and can fluctuate depending on the factors we discussed earlier. Always research and prepare yourself with the skills and experience needed to command a higher salary.
Boosting Your iOS Developer Salary: Tips and Tricks
Alright, guys, you want to increase your earning potential as an iOS developer in Egypt? Awesome! Here are some practical tips and tricks to help you climb the salary ladder. Let's start with skills development. Continuously honing your skills is crucial. Besides mastering Swift and Objective-C, expand your knowledge by learning new frameworks, libraries, and tools. Stay updated with the latest iOS updates and development trends. Consider taking courses, attending workshops, or getting certifications to demonstrate your expertise and commitment to your profession. Networking is super important. Building a strong professional network can open doors to new opportunities. Attend industry events, join online communities, and connect with other developers and potential employers. Networking can lead to job offers, collaborations, and valuable insights into the job market. Another tip is to build a strong portfolio. Showcase your skills and experience by creating a portfolio of your projects. This can include apps you've worked on, open-source contributions, or personal projects. A well-presented portfolio demonstrates your abilities and can impress potential employers. Don't be afraid to take on freelance projects or side gigs. Freelancing can provide additional income and allow you to gain experience in various projects and industries. It also gives you more control over your earnings and allows you to build a diverse portfolio. Perfecting your interview skills is essential. Prepare for technical interviews by practicing coding challenges, answering behavioral questions, and researching the company. Be prepared to discuss your skills, experience, and the projects you've worked on. Don't underestimate the importance of salary negotiation. Research industry standards, know your worth, and be prepared to negotiate your salary. Practice your negotiation skills and be confident in your abilities. Finally, consider specializing in a niche. Focusing on a specific area of iOS development, such as augmented reality, app security, or UI/UX design, can make you more valuable and command a higher salary. Specialized skills are often in high demand, and the competition is usually less fierce. By implementing these strategies, you can significantly improve your chances of earning a higher salary as an iOS developer in Egypt.
The iOS Developer Job Market in Egypt: A Quick Look
Let’s take a closer look at the iOS developer job market in Egypt. The tech industry in Egypt is growing, with a rising demand for skilled developers. Several factors are fueling this growth. The increasing adoption of smartphones and mobile devices has led to a surge in demand for mobile apps, creating more job opportunities for iOS developers. The government's initiatives to support the tech sector and attract foreign investment have also contributed to the growth of the industry. Cairo and Alexandria are the main hubs for the tech industry, hosting many startups, tech companies, and multinational corporations with iOS development needs. The job market is competitive, so it's essential to stand out. Companies often look for candidates with strong technical skills, experience, and a portfolio of projects. Soft skills, such as communication, teamwork, and problem-solving, are also super important. The future of the iOS developer job market in Egypt looks promising. As the tech industry continues to grow and digital transformation accelerates, the demand for skilled iOS developers is expected to increase. This presents opportunities for career growth and increased earning potential. To stay ahead of the game, continuously update your skills, build your network, and stay informed about the latest trends in the industry.
Finding iOS Developer Jobs in Egypt
Alright, guys, let’s talk about how to find those awesome iOS developer jobs in Egypt. There are a few key strategies you can use to land your dream job. First off, leverage online job boards. Websites like LinkedIn, Bayt.com, and Naukri Gulf are great for finding job postings and connecting with potential employers. You can set up alerts to get notified about new job openings that match your skills and experience. Networking is your secret weapon. Attend industry events, join online communities, and connect with other developers. Networking can lead to job referrals and valuable insights into the job market. Another great way is to go to company websites directly. Many companies post job openings on their websites. This allows you to learn about the company and submit a tailored application. Consider using recruitment agencies. Recruitment agencies specialize in matching candidates with employers. They can help you find job openings that match your skills and experience and assist with the application process. Create a killer resume and cover letter. Your resume should highlight your skills, experience, and projects. Tailor your resume and cover letter to each job application, emphasizing the skills and experience that are most relevant to the role. Lastly, prepare for interviews. Practice your coding skills, research the company, and prepare for technical and behavioral questions. Be ready to showcase your skills and explain your experience. By using these methods, you'll be well on your way to finding an amazing iOS developer job in Egypt.
Conclusion: Your iOS Developer Journey in Egypt
So, there you have it, guys! This article has provided you with a comprehensive overview of the iOS developer salary in Egypt. We've covered everything from average salary ranges and factors influencing pay to tips on boosting your earning potential and navigating the job market. Remember that the tech industry is dynamic, and continuous learning is key. Keep honing your skills, building your network, and staying updated with the latest trends. By doing so, you'll be well-positioned to succeed in your iOS development career in Egypt. The iOS developer salary in Egypt can be quite rewarding, so take what you’ve learned and start putting it into practice today. Good luck on your iOS development journey, and don’t be afraid to ask for help along the way! You've got this!